Transaction 7afbb08fff5111d2eb2516569e8ee6974fc0f86cc49e2780ece92eed40e2def8

1 Input
2 Outputs
  • 7afbb08fff5111d2eb2516569e8ee6974fc0f86cc49e2780ece92eed40e2def8:0
  • value  2835710
    address  3FXaMwfNmCT1gmze16rnjdNEpDiF55T5gr
  • 7afbb08fff5111d2eb2516569e8ee6974fc0f86cc49e2780ece92eed40e2def8:1
  • value  58014
    address  3FEh7JhjEF73BAAEGjiKU17fKJmdkbA4VR